⁠⁠⁠The Senior Business Analyst will report to the Digital Health Implementer Hub Product Manager within the Conformance Compliance Section in the Digital Solutions Division. The role will be accountable under broad direction to perform very complex work that provides detailed technical and professional business analysis, system analysis, and design changes that align with the vision and strategic direction of the Agency.

This role will support the delivery of the Streamlining Implementations, Conformance and Connections (SLICC) project. This project aims to build on the critical and foundational work and capabilities delivered addressing our strategic goals:

  • Improve business processes and workflows to reduce administrative burden, duplication of effort, and time to complete onboarding and connecting to the Agency.
  • Better utilise the Developer Portal as a two-way developer engagement and support channel
  • Implement organisational changes to rationalise and harmonise the delivery of connections and conformance services

The Senior Business Analyst will exercise a considerable degree of independence and perform a leadership role working closely with internal and external stakeholders to gain an in-depth understanding of business processes, technical infrastructure, technical services, strategic roadmap, and in the context in which the SLICC project operates.

The Senior Business Analyst will act as the conduit between the business units, and internal stakeholders that will include the external Implementers, Connections team, Technical Architects, Conformance team and solutions implementation teams within the Agency and with relevant stakeholders from the health sector.
